- [ ] **Step 7: Breaker override escrow.** After sealing the signing keys for the Tallgrove upstream API circuit breaker, confirm the support team can force the breaker open during a full outage. The override bundle lives in the sealed escrow drawer and is useless without its unlock phrase. Two ceremony witnesses must initial this step before proceeding. The escrow bundle is decrypted with the recovery passphrase that follows.

vault phrase of kahip-kahop = holath-quenmir

Visiting contractors may use the quiet room on the top floor of Thorncliff House for calls and focused work only. No meetings, no food, phones on silent. The room is unbookable; first come, first served. Leave it as found. Contractors must sign in at reception before heading up. The door is keypad-locked; enter with the code below.

door code, yahif-yagag: bdg-FKXEAK-64235764

**14:22 UTC** — The circuit breaker guarding the Fernwhistle upstream API tripped after error rates crossed the 40% threshold. Since you're new to the Larkspur platform: this breaker protects our checkout flow from cascading timeouts when Fernwhistle degrades. On-call engineer Priya confirmed the breaker opened correctly and half-open probes began at 14:25. Recovery was clean, but probe intervals were tighter than documented, which we're fixing. The exact build that shipped the corrected probe config is recorded below.

pipeline stamp: htk9_6ce9d33c5